Re: Install setup URL
I wouldn't recommend it, because if your dates are off by even 1 second it will prevent TimeTrex from ever being able to automatically creating pay periods for you again, due to conflicts.
TimeTrex will automatically "catch up", however by default it only creates one pay period per day, or each time the AddPayPeriod maintenance job is run. So if you are 6 pay periods behind, simply run the following command 6x and you will be caught up instantly:
Code: Select all
php-win.exe AddPayPeriod.php
